題名 | 生產膽固醇氧化酶培養基組成份之起泡性及除泡劑之選擇=Foaming Property of Medium Components and the Choice of Antifoam Agents in the Production of Cholesterol Oxidase |

中文摘要 | 本研究探討發酵槽中具有剪力的環境下,利用Rhodococcus equi No.23生產膽固 醇氧化脢,培養基組成份之起泡特性,並針對數種除泡劑之適合性進行評估。結果發現所測試 培養液之組成份中,酵母抽出物和 Tween-80 乃為起泡的主要成份。其中以 Tween-80 的起 泡能力最高,而酵母抽出物的泡沫穩定性最佳。在發酵槽中,以液面下通氣的方式進行生產 膽固醇氧化脢時, 雖添加除泡劑並不能完全抑制泡沫的產生, 但若添加 0.4%(v/v)Antifoam-289 時則有利發酵操作之進行, 避免溢流之發生。 在培養液中添加 Antifoam-289,採用液面下通氣培養時,膽固醇氧化脢活性最高點可達約 0.25unti/mL。而 採用液面上通氣培養時,酵素活性最高點只有約 0.11unit/mL。 |
英文摘要 | The foaming property of some componets in medium for the production of cholesterol oxedase using Rhodococcus equi No. 23 and the effectiveness of an antifoam agent in a fermenter were investigated. It was found that yeast extract and Tween-80 were the major components responsible for foaming in the culture medium. Foam initiated by Tween-80 was thicker while the foam formed from yeast extract was more stable. When cholesterol oxidase was produced in a fermenter with submerged aeration, the addition of antifoam agents could not completely repress the formation of foam. However, the addition of 0.4%(v/v) Antifoam-289 could prevent overflow in the fermenter and improve the fermentation process. With the addition of Antifoam-289 and submerged aeration, a maximum cholesterol oxidase activity of 0.25 unit/mL could be achieved in the culture of R. equi no. 23, while no more than 0.11 unit/mL could be obtained in the culture with only head space aeration. |
